Battaristis pasadenae
Battaristis pasadenae is a small moth in the family Gelechiidae, described by Keifer in 1935. It is known from California in western North America. The species has a wingspan of approximately 11–12 mm and exhibits distinctive wing patterning with white markings on a fuscous background. Very few observations of this species have been recorded.
